More Communication Time
Another goal for the year is setting the time to communicate with each other as a family. Talking and listening to your partner and children is an important goal to set for the new year. This will benefit the family by creating a bonding experience. It will encourage you to focus on long term goals you want to achieve together.
As parents, setting the time to communicate should be an intentional thing in this new year. After dinner, set out time to talk with the children before bedtime. And with your spouse make time to talk and really listen to build understanding.

Create a Family Budget
Going into the new year, financial wellness is essential in our goals for the year, and for that to be possible we need to make budgeting a family thing. This can be a difficult goal to set, especially as a family, but being intentional and sticking with it will make it work. Eliminating or trimming unnecessary expenses can be discussed in the family and every input from all members of the family will be accounted for.


Eating Meals Together
Family mealtime is an important goal to set for the new year. This can be challenging for most families as external factors such as work come into play and affect mealtime. It seems like a simple goal to set for the year, but being intentional about it will make this goal come to fruition.

Set a goal to have dinner two to three times in week through the year; this will be of benefit to parents and children to talk about how the week was, the challenges, and offer solutions for each member of the family.

Have a Family Hobby
This is important for family togetherness in the new year. Having a set of activities that every member of the family can participate in is a great goal to have through the course of the year. It can be innovative as families can learn something new and have new communication skills and equally fun to improve the family mentally and physically.

Some examples of these hobbies can be indoor or outdoor games, exercising, decluttering the home etc. Over time, spending time on this goal will encourage bonding as a family.
